• "I'll Be Lovin' U Long Time" Mediabase airplay update as of week ending June 21, 2008: 2.003 million audience impressions with 108 spins (Pop - 15, Rhythmic - 47, Urban - 41, Urban A/C - 5). • Stevie Wonder mentions Mariah in an interview with The Boston Globe (http://www.boston.com/ae/music/articles/2008/06/21/wonder_is_writing_songs_in_the_key_of_his_life/):
Q. Some of your biggest fans have become popular musicians. Is that always flattering?
A. To me it's an honor, and it's also a challenge, and so I'm influenced by the various people that are coming up as they say they are influenced by me. I like Alicia [Keys], I like Mariah [Carey], always taking chances doing different stuff. I think India[.Arie] is very talented. I'm a big John Mayer fan. I think [Justin Timberlake's] very talented, and it would be fun to work with him on stuff.
• Rumor Mill: Chicago Sun-Times (http://www.suntimes.com/news/sneed/1013823,CST-NWS-SNEED19.article) columnist Michael Sneed reports that Mariah Carey has written a song called "100 percent," which she wants Barack Obama to use as his campaign theme song. Top tip: Word is Carey wrote it in hopes it would become a theme for the Olympics, but reconsidered once Barack became the presumed Dem presidential candidate. The song has yet to be recorded.
• From Newsday (http://www.newsday.com/entertainment/music/ny-ffmus5731843jun22,0,5320096.story?track=rss): Though her career is filled with classics - from "Lady Marmalade" to "New Attitude" - in recent years, Patti LaBelle hasn't had a big hit, despite releasing strong albums and working with hot producers. She wants to change that with a new solo album set for later this year that she hopes will include work with Mariah Carey and Ne-Yo, but she's not counting on it.
